"You've got the Milky Way spread out over your head and you're looking down towards Jupiter, Saturn and The shower is named after the faint Eta Aquarii star in the Aquarius Constellation, which acts as its radiant point - the area of the night sky that the meteors appear to emanate from.The water jar is in the southern part of the constellation for those in the Southern Hemisphere, and the northern part for those in the Northern Hemisphere. Comet 1P/Halley can be observed from Earth once every 75-76 years and is probably the most well known comet under the “household name” of Halley’s Comet.

The debris that create the Eta Aquariids originally came from Halley's Comet. The first known sighting of this comet occurred in the year 240 and was duly recorded by the Chinese. The shower will peak in the early morning hours of May 6, between 2 and 5 am AEST, (between 16:00 and 17:00 UTC, May 5).
